Bust left
Script: Latin
Lettering: JAMES SADLER. FIRST ENGLISH AERONAUT
Engraver: Peter Wyon
Balloon with decorated gondola
Script: Latin
Lettering:
THE 21 ASCENT
OCTOBER 7. 1811.
ASCENDED FROM BIRMINGHAM. TRAVERS'D UPWARDS OF 112 MILES.IN 1 HOUR & 20 MINUTES.
